Friends

Friends are those people,
Who know that you’re mad,
And let you be mad.
They know that you’re hurt
And let you be hurt.

But when the anger has died
And your tears they have dried,
They reach out to lift you up once again
They reach out to help you heal from the pain

They reach out to show you
What it is you must do
And carry you time and again
To the road to be strong once again.

Friends always tell you
When you’re being a fool
Friends will not let you
Be somebody’s fool

Friends fill up your lonely space
With kindness and grace
Replacing your strife
With love and with life

let your hair down

Go right ahead, let your hair down
Proudly present the flaws and the frayed, as assigned... tis now grayed
With uneven cutting from past days and old ways
On purpose the colors have changed with time
Locked in are seasons and the reasons of life
Ponder the tales and share lessons learned
To those who do not have the length yet.. as earned
Guide them with each strand of wisdom
to better cover their young souls within them
Adorn the waves of what flows freely
with wind, every storm
let the rain cleanse completely
Cherish each curl of the tides that are... un neatly
Whether they be soft and quiet
or rough and loud
They each matter and needed to be
in order to become you and me
